View All Saved Items Rate Print Share Share Tweet Pin Email Add Photo 3 3 Prep Time: 10 mins Additional Time: 4 hrs Total Time: 4 hrs 10 mins Servings: 4 Yield: 4 servings Jump to Nutrition Facts Ingredients ½ cup peeled, chopped fresh California peaches ⅓ cup peeled, pureed fresh California peaches ⅔ cup nonfat vanilla yogurt Directions Puree 1/2 cup of peaches in blender or food processor until smooth. Lightly swirl together peach puree, yogurt and remaining 1/2 cup of peaches together in a small bowl. Spoon into 4 popsicle molds and insert handle. Freeze for at least 4 hours. Tips * For extra sweet pops, add 1-2 tablespoons of honey to yogurt before swirling.
